If you’re planning a trip between Christchurch and Wellington, you’re in luck: this is one of New Zealand’s busiest domestic routes, with multiple daily non-stop options. Whether you’re heading to the capital for business or a weekend getaway, the flight itself is quick – often under an hour and a half.

Flight time: Approx. 1 hour 25 minutes ·
Distance: 302 km (188 miles) ·
Airlines: Air New Zealand, Jetstar ·
Daily departures: Over 15 ·
Cheapest one‑way: From NZ$73 (Skyscanner)

Are there direct flights from Christchurch to Wellington?

Yes, direct non‑stop flights are available every day. The primary carrier is Air New Zealand (New Zealand’s flag carrier), which operates multiple daily direct services. Skyscanner (travel aggregator) also lists Jetstar as a direct carrier on this route, though its schedule is less consistent.

What airlines operate direct flights?

  • Air New Zealand – offers over 10 non‑stop flights on most days, using Airbus A320 and ATR 72 aircraft (Air New Zealand).
  • Jetstar – provides occasional direct services; check current schedules on Jetstar (low‑cost carrier).

How many direct flights per day?

Air New Zealand alone runs over 10 daily non‑stop flights, and Skyscanner estimates 173 weekly flights across all carriers. That’s more than 20 per day at peak times.

The implication: Direct flights are plentiful, but you’ll want to book early for peak departure windows (7–9 am and 4–6 pm) to secure your preferred time.

How can I find cheap flights from Christchurch to Wellington?

Prices vary, but Expedia (travel booking platform) says the cheapest month to fly this route is June, when demand dips. Skyscanner has seen one‑way fares as low as NZ$73. Booking 2–3 months ahead is a common rule of thumb.

  • Use price‑alert tools on Skyscanner or Google Flights to get notified when fares drop.
  • Be flexible with departure times – early‑morning and late‑evening flights are often cheaper.
  • Compare Air New Zealand’s direct fares from NZ$109 (Air New Zealand – official pricing) against Jetstar’s promotional offers.

What are the cheapest months to fly?

June (winter) is consistently cheapest, according to Expedia. May and August also offer good value. Summer months (December–February) see higher fares due to holiday travel.

How to use price alerts?

Both Google Flights (price‑tracking tool) and Skyscanner let you set alerts for specific dates. Activate tracking for the CHC–WLG route and wait for a NZ$80–100 range before booking.

The trade‑off: Saving money often means accepting a less convenient time or booking months ahead. For last‑minute trips, Air New Zealand’s “The Works” fare is the safest option, but it costs more.

What flights does Air New Zealand offer from Christchurch to Wellington?

Air New Zealand is the dominant carrier, offering multiple non‑stop flights every day from about 6:30 am to 8:55 pm, as shown by Skyscanner’s schedule data. The airline uses a mix of Airbus A320 (jet) and ATR 72 (turboprop) aircraft.

What is the schedule of Air NZ flights?

  • Earliest departure: 06:30 (Skyscanner data)
  • Latest departure: 20:55
  • Frequency: Roughly every 60–90 minutes during the day.

Check the official Air New Zealand website for the most current schedule.

What are the fare classes?

Air New Zealand offers three main fare options on this domestic route:

  • Seat – the basic fare, includes a personal device entertainment and a snack.
  • The Works – adds a checked bag, seat selection, and a meal or snacks.
  • Flexitime – highest flexibility, allows free changes and a full refund.

Why this matters: For a short 1‑hour flight, the Seat fare is often enough. But if you need to check a bag or change your booking later, The Works pays off quickly.

Frequently asked questions

What is the distance between Christchurch and Wellington?

The straight‑line distance is 302 km (188 miles). The flight path is slightly longer due to air traffic routing, but the block time still fits inside 90 minutes.

How can I track my flight from Christchurch to Wellington?

Use FlightAware (live flight tracking service) or the official Air New Zealand app. Enter the flight number for real‑time departure, arrival, and delay information.

What airlines fly from Christchurch to Wellington besides Air NZ?

Skyscanner identifies Jetstar as a direct carrier, though its schedule is less frequent. No other airlines serve the route on a regular basis.

Is it cheaper to fly or drive from Christchurch to Wellington?

Driving takes about 5–6 hours and costs roughly NZ$100 in fuel plus vehicle wear. A one‑way flight can be as low as NZ$73, so flying is often cheaper if you book in advance and don’t need a car at your destination.

What is the best time of day to fly?

For punctuality, early‑morning flights (before 8 am) have the highest on‑time performance. For lower fares, consider late‑afternoon departures. Avoid Monday mornings and Friday evenings for less crowded planes.

How early should I arrive at the airport for domestic flights?

The Civil Aviation Authority of New Zealand (aviation regulator) recommends arriving at least 30 minutes before domestic departure. For a stress‑free experience, aim for 45 minutes.

Can I use Airpoints Dollars for Christchurch to Wellington flights?

Yes, Air New Zealand allows you to redeem Airpoints Dollars on any available seat. Check availability on the Air New Zealand website.
